National Children's Craft Day is celebrated on March 14 and aims to encourage children's creative activities. This day is dedicated to crafting, art, and self-expression through creativity. It is important for children to have the opportunity on this day to freely develop their creative skills without limitations or rules.

When and why is National Children's Craft Day celebrated?
National Children's Craft Day was created to help children develop their skills through art and crafts. On this day, various activities are organized to encourage children to use their imagination and creativity to create various handmade objects and works of art. This day also serves as a reminder of the importance of these activities in a child's overall development.

This day highlights how important it is for children to develop their creative talents and how art can be not only a useful but also a fun activity that helps improve motor skills, concentration, and self-confidence.

Goals of the day
The main goals of National Children's Craft Day include:
- Encouraging children to engage in art and crafts.
- Stimulating children's imagination and creativity.
- Developing problem-solving skills through art.
- Improving fine motor skills and coordination.
- Highlighting the importance of creativity in children's development.

How can National Children's Craft Day be celebrated?
There are several ways to celebrate this day and encourage children to develop their creative skills:
- Organize crafting, painting, or sculpture workshops.
- Host art competitions for children, awarding the best creative works.
- Organize exhibitions of children's works in schools, kindergartens, or cultural centers.
- Create joint projects with children, such as making a family collage or decorating rooms.
- Discuss with children the importance of art and its role in everyone's life.

Why is it important to foster creativity in children?
Fostering creativity in children is important for several reasons:
- It helps children express their thoughts, emotions, and feelings.
- Creativity contributes to the development of problem-solving skills and critical thinking.
- It boosts self-confidence and promotes independence.
- Through art, children learn patience, attention to detail, and the ability to complete tasks.
- Participating in creative activities develops fine motor skills and improves movement coordination.
